Dog Bites

I find it sad and ridiculous (and minutely amusing) that after more than two-hundred years or so of service, the United States Postal Service is still having to deal with one of its biggest problems: dog bites.

In response to National Dog Bite Prevention Week, which is going on May 21-27, the USPS issued a news release discussing the problem and offering suggestions to customers to help minimize the occurrences. It also offers tips on how to avoid being bitten, like "Don't run past a dog; If a dog threatens you, don't scream; Avoid eye contact;" as well as tips on how to be a responsible dog owner. If you own a dog, which, with an estimated sixty million dogs in the United States, many of us are, it wouldn't hurt to take a look at it.

The news release also tells us the top cities for dog bites suffered by mail carriers in the United States. The #1 city for dog bites? Houston! Like I said, sad and ridiculous.
